Kalma wins Monday Club title

Sunnexdesk

THE Kalma Basketball Squad displayed its full arsenal in a 75-59 routing over PN Alumni in the championship game of the Monday Squad Basketball Club (MSBC) Basketball League Season 3 at the Casal’s Village Gym last Sunday.

Team Kalma took the lead early in the first quarter and proved to be too much for PN Alumni en route to taking the crown in the 5’10” and under basketball tournament in dominating-fashion.

JR Saga and Rannel Cortes paced Team Kalma as they combined for 44 points. The two also combined for 19 points in the opening quarter to give Team Kalma a 23-18 edge.

The bench players also stepped up for Team Kalma, pacing the team in the second quarter and limiting PN Alumni to only eight points for a double-digit edge, 37-26, at the half.

The PN Alumni tried to stage a fightback early in the third quarter but Team Kalma had the answers for every run and managed to keep a double-digit lead at 52-42 going to the final quarter.

Cortes and Saga again torched their opponents in the final quarter as they connived for 16 points to finish off PN Alumni with a 16-point edge..

Alwin Dapdap and JR Bucatan scored 13 points each, while Harold Gemida handed 11 in a losing effort for PN Alumni. (RSC)
